Consumer Confidence Continues Ascent in June
The Conference Board Consumer Confidence Index, which had increased in May, improved again in June. The Index now stands at 85.2 (1985=100), up from 82.2 in May. The Present Situation Index increased to 85.1 from 80.3, while the Expectations Index rose to

RECALL: 650 Tern Folding Bicycles
The importer of Tern Folding Bicycles is recalling about 650 bikes in the United States and 20 in Canada because the bike’s frame can crack at the hinge on the top tube and pose a fall hazard…
